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Inclusion Criteria for TD children:
  • between the age of 7 and 18 years
  • who are typically developing
  • able to stand and walk alone without using assistance or assistive devices
  • able to place their feet flat on the force platforms
  • with enough German language skills to follow the instructions
  • Inclusion Criteria for sCP children:
  • between the age of 7 and 18 years
  • with the diagnosis of spastic CP or CP similar (both unilateral and bilateral), functionally classified level I or II according to the Gross Motor Function Classification System (GMFCS)
  • being able to stand and walk alone without assistance or assistive devices
  • able to place their feet flat on the force platforms
  • with enough German language skills to follow the instructions
  • Exclusion Criteria for TD children:
  • severe visual, cognitive, or auditory impairments that would interfere with the study instructions and the VR immersion
  • any vestibular problems (e.g. severe motion sickness)
  • history of epilepsy, pace-marker or/and electrical pumps (due to possible interference with electrical stimulation)
  • prior experience of VR to ensure a comparable baseline between subjects
  • Exclusion Criteria for sCP children:
  • severe visual, cognitive, or auditory impairments that would interfere with the study instructions and the VR immersion
  • severe knee flexion gait (\>45°)
  • walking capacity \<50m
  • botulinum toxin type A treatment (past 6 months)
  • orthopedic surgery of upper or lower extremities (past 12 months)
  • any vestibular problems (e.g. severe motion sickness or dizziness)
  • history of epilepsy, pace-marker or/and electrical pumps (due to possible interference with electrical stimulation)
  • prior experience of VR as they may already be adapted to VR.
